2009 Russian River Valley Zinfandel
The Gary Farrell Maffei Vineyard Zinfandel from the 2009 vintage is a splendid representation of the Russian River Valley, showcasing the region's unique terroir. This red wine is medium-bodied, offering a delightful balance that invites you to savor every sip. Its acidity is bright and refreshing, enhancing the vibrant fruit flavors that leap from the glass. With prominent notes of blackberry, a touch of plum, and hints of pepper, this Zinfandel is truly fruit-forward and inviting. The tannins are notable yet refined, providing structure without overwhelming the palate. This wine is beautifully dry, making it a versatile companion to a variety of dishes, from grilled meats to hearty pastas.
